To Enable Minidumps:

  1. Go to Start, in the Search Box type: sysdm.cpl, press Enter.
  2. Under the Advanced tab, click on the Startup and Recovery > Settings... button.
  3. Ensure that Automatically restart is unchecked.
  4. Under the Write Debugging Information header select Small memory dump (256 kB) in the dropdown box (the 256kb varies).
  5. Ensure that the Small Dump Directory is listed as %systemroot%\Minidump.
  6. OK your way out.
  7. Reboot if changes have been made.
The *.dmp files are located at C:\Windows\Minidump. Until a *.dmp file is generated, the Minidump folder may not exist.
GoTo your C:\Windows\Minidump folder. Copy the *.dmp files to a new folder on your desktop. Zip up the *.dmp files from that folder and attach to a post.

Download the attached rkill.com. Boot to Safe Mode and run rkill.com. Note that if rkill finds any baddies it does not remove them, it stops them thus making them unable to defend themselves from removal by other means (Malwarebytes). Immediately after rkill.scr has finished, regardless of the results, run a FULL scan with Malwarebytes.

STOP 0x0000004E: PFN_LIST_CORRUPT

Usual causes:
Device driver, ?memory.

Your latest dump file lists Memory_Corruption as the probable cause which usually indicates out of date Drivers, Bad Memory or incorrectly configured Memory Timings.
Old and incompatible drivers can and do cause issues with Windows 7, often giving false error codes. Random stop codes can often indicate hardware issues.
